DESCRIPTION:

Duties and Responsibilities:
  • Calibration of engine control (EFI/OBD) for North America and global markets
  • Complete engine calibration in accordance with procedures to meet regulations and other performance targets (emission, fuel economy, power, drivability and OBD)
  • Prepare and manage calibration and resource schedule to meet development deadlines
  • Test preparation, data collection, data analysis, and technical report creation on a regular basis
  • Build successful relationship with calibration technician group
  • Conduct vehicle testing and development under extreme environmental conditions (hot, cold, high altitude)
  • Complete required internal training necessary for job execution (Technical, Driving, etc.)
